Program Managers lead multiple projects, ensuring organisational goals are met by coordinating teams, managing risks, and developing strategies.

In Australia, a full time Program Manager generally earns $2,395 per week ($124,540 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ience can you expect a higher salary than people who are new to the role.

Program Managers have leadership expertise and are usually degree qualified in their industry of employment sector. Compliment your existing qualifications with the Advanced Diploma of Program Management or the Graduate Diploma of Portfolio Management. These courses take 12-18 months to complete.

If you’re considering a career as a Program Manager in Coffs Harbour, you’ll find a diverse range of Program Manager courses in Coffs Harbour tailored to suit various skill levels. Whether you are starting your journey with no prior experience or seeking to advance your existing qualifications, there's an abundance of choices. For beginners, introductory courses such as the Maintain Training and Assessment Information TAETAS411 or the Volunteer Trainer Delivery Skill Set TAESS00029 are excellent starting points. These courses offer critical insights into essential practices that can greatly benefit aspiring program managers.

For those with prior experience, intermediate and advanced course offerings are available, including the Diploma of Project Management BSB50820 and the Advanced Diploma of Program Management BSB60720. These qualifications are designed to deepen your understanding and enhance your capability in managing complex projects, preparing you for senior roles in various sectors within the Coffs Harbour region. By enrolling in these courses, you will gain the skills and knowledge to efficiently oversee project life cycles and team collaboration.

Additionally, pursuing a career as a Program Manager opens the door to various related job roles such as a Project Manager, Project Coordinator, or an Change Manager, all of which are essential in today’s project-driven environments.
